About
Dungeon Highway drops you into a delightfully stylized fantasy world filled to the brim with dastardly monsters. Heart-pounding action, nostalgic graphics and an enchanting chiptune soundtrack bring a new milestone to the genre of endless arcade racing.

Dungeon Highway — Session FAQ
- How long does a session of Dungeon Highway take?
- The minimum meaningful session for Dungeon Highway is approximately 5 minutes. This is the shortest play window where you can make real progress or have a satisfying experience, based on community data.
- Can you pause Dungeon Highway?
- Dungeon Highway cannot be paused mid-session (it runs in real-time or is multiplayer). Plan for a full session window before starting.
- Does Dungeon Highway pressure you to keep playing?
- Dungeon Highway has low FOMO. There may be some narrative momentum, but the game doesn't pressure you to keep playing. Natural stopping points are common.
- What is Dungeon Highway's Session Respect Score?
- Dungeon Highway has a Session Respect Score of 6.5/10. This score combines minimum session length, pausability, FOMO level, and pickup friendliness into a single metric for how well the game fits busy schedules.
